A driver who refuses to take a breath test in nj is subject to a violation surcharge of:

the answer is $1000 a year for 3 years.
According to the regulation in the state of New Jersey, people who refuse to take a Breath test are subjected to pay a certain amount of fine depending on the location where they're caught.
The largest amount are given to the area with the largerst amount of children such as School and parks (with the punishment of $1000 a year for 3 years and 4 year loss of driving privilege)
